Shift operation when [F1-R1] mode is set
When the preset mode switch is turned ON, the [F1-R1] mode is set by default.
After that, if the steering, directional, and speed lever is operated forward (forward travel operation), the
transmission is shifted to F1.
If it is operated back (reverse travel operation), the transmission is shifted to R1.
Shift operation when [F1-R2] mode is set
When the steering, directional, and speed lever is in the N position, if the up switch is pressed once, the mode
is set to [F1-R2] mode. After that, if the steering, directional, and speed lever is operated forward (forward travel
operation), the transmission is shifted to F1. If it is moved back (reverse travel operation), the transmission is
shifted to R2.
Shift operation when [F2-R2] mode is set
When the steering, directional, and speed lever is in the N position, if the up switch is pressed twice, the mode
is set to [F2-R2] mode. After that, if the steering, directional, and speed lever is operated forward (forward travel
operation), the transmission is shifted to F2. If it is moved back (reverse travel operation), the transmission is
shifted to R2.
REMARK
Even when the mode is set to [F1-R1] mode, [F1-R2] mode, or [F2-R2] mode, it is possible to switch to the desired
speed range simply by operating the up switch or down switch.
For example, when the mode is set to [F1-R2] mode, if the steering, directional, and speed lever is moved forward
(forward travel operation), the transmission is shifted to F1, but if up switch (a) is pressed once with the lever pushed
forward, the transmission is shifted to F2; if it is pressed twice, the transmission is shifted to F3. If the down switch
(b) is pressed once when the transmission is in F3, the transmission is shifted to F2; if it is pressed twice, the
transmission is shifted to F1.
If the steering, directional, and speed lever is moved back (reverse travel operation), the transmission is shifted to
R2, but if up switch (a) is pressed once with the lever pulled back, the transmission is shifted to R3; if down switch
(b) is pressed once, the transmission is shifted to R1.
However, the mode remains in the [F1-R2] mode. If the steering, directional, and speed lever is returned to the N
position and operated forward again (forward travel operation), the transmission is shifted to F1. If it is moved back
(reverse travel operation), the transmission is shifted to R2.
